Abstract

The results of research on the development of a method for determining the amount of water required for soaking dry and semi-dry soils during their impact compaction are presented. At the same time, the process of compacting the soil of the inter-pile space when stamping a trench in it under a low monolithic grillage of a single-row pile foundation is considered. The order of water movement during soil soaking in a cramped pile space has been determined. Two variants of tasks are considered, taking into account the possibility of forming different forms of a moistened zone under a local soaking source. The cramped conditions for the formation of a moistened soil zone in the inter-pile space are taken into account. Based on the theoretical solutions obtained, comparative calculations were performed, which allowed us to establish that the difference in results does not exceed 10%. The method is recommended for use with a preliminary experimental refinement of a number of coefficients included in the final formulas.
